Small Kitchen Remodeling in Dayton, OH
Small kitchen remodeling services focus on updating and enhancing existing kitchen spaces to improve functionality, aesthetics, and overall value. These projects often include replacing cabinets, countertops, or appliances, as well as updating lighting, flooring, and fixtures. Homeowners typically seek these services to modernize their kitchens, increase storage options, or create a more efficient layout, all while maintaining the current footprint of the space. It’s important for property owners to consider their specific needs, style preferences, and budget before requesting a remodeling project to ensure the results align with their expectations.
Before requesting small kitchen remodeling services, property owners should understand the scope of work involved, including potential disruptions to daily routines and any structural considerations. Clarifying desired design elements, materials, and finishes can help guide the project planning process. Additionally, understanding the timeline, any necessary permits, and the impact on existing utilities can contribute to a smoother renovation experience. Proper planning and clear communication can help ensure the remodeling process meets the homeowner’s goals efficiently and effectively.

Small Kitchen Remodeling Questions
What is small kitchen remodeling? It involves updating or redesigning a compact kitchen space to improve functionality and appearance.
What types of changes are common in small kitchen remodels? Typical updates include new cabinets, countertops, lighting, and appliance placements.
Will a small kitchen remodel increase property value? Yes, well-designed updates can enhance the appeal and functionality of a kitchen, adding value to a property.
What should homeowners consider before remodeling a small kitchen? It's important to plan for efficient use of space, storage options, and layout improvements to maximize the area.
